I just recently bought some flush mounts for my blue 09 fz6r and as you know the stock light has 3 wires green blue and black well these flush mounts only have 2 wires black and yellow anyone know what to do with it? what connects to what
 

JSP

Super Moderator
The stock signals have the extra wire so they work as "running lights" Most aftermarket ones do not have that "feature". So you will only hook up the two.

MikeN02

New Member
Seems about right. All you need to really worry about is the ground which is usually black.

If you cross the running light and the turn signal wire itself the worst that would happen is the turn signals won't blink and you'd have to rewire them.

Now... if you crossed the positive wire with the ground, that would blow a fuse.

ok so anyone know how these bullet connectors work? do you just feed the wire in from both sides and pinch it with a pliers or what?
 

MikeN02

New Member
This is what i'm having trouble with. i cant find anything on how to use these connectors
Ah crimps. Their okay to use. You insert the wires on each end.

---- ( ) -------

Then clamp down the "crimp" so the wires lock in there and you can't pull them out.

I love wiring. This is what I use:

I use these to crimp, because you can crimp with the front. Stripping the wire sucks with these:

Performance Tool W190C Wire Crimper and Stripper Tool

This is what I use to strip wires, because it is a superior stripping tool. It will strip any size wire, no adjustments needed. It can crimp, but it is awkward because you have to crimp between the grips.

Those connectors you have there are actually waterproof. The transparent color tips you off to that. Basically, crimp your wires in there, and then use a lighter, aim-n-flame, or heat gun and heat it up, and it will shrink to the wire creating a water tight seal. Happy wiring!!
